Who it's for
- Gardeners looking to speed up large-scale bulb planting projects
- Users with limited mobility seeking to minimize physical digging strain
- DIYers needing a versatile tool for mixing and soil aeration
Who should skip it
- Gardeners working in rocky, root-filled, or heavily compacted clay soil
- Casual DIYers who lack high-torque cordless power drills
- Users concerned about wrist safety or potential tool kickback

Know before you buy
This auger is designed to fit most standard cordless drills that feature a 1/2-inch chuck. It uses a 3/8-inch non-slip hex drive, which ensures a secure connection so the bit doesn't spin inside the drill chuck while you work.
Yes, the DIY Guru Auger is built with durable carbon steel and a conical blade tip specifically designed to penetrate and break up dense or clay-heavy soil. It effectively leaves the soil loose, which is ideal for root development.
The auger has an overall length of 12 inches, allowing for a maximum planting depth of approximately 11 inches. This is suitable for almost all bulb sizes and many small potted plants.
Beyond planting, this tool is excellent for mixing soil amendments, fertilizers, or compost directly into your garden beds. It is also a great time-saver for installing small landscape edging or garden stakes.
Because it is made from durable steel, it is best to wipe the auger clean of dirt and moisture after each use to prevent rust. Storing it in a dry place will ensure the tool remains in good condition for many seasons.
